What to Wear with Black Straight Fit Jeans Men
Casual Looks: Effortless and Comfortable
For laid-back days or casual outings, pairing black straight fit jeans with comfortable and stylish tops creates a relaxed yet put-together appearance. The versatility of black jeans allows for a variety of casual combinations.
- Basic T-Shirts: Classic white, grey, or striped t-shirts are timeless options. Tuck in the t-shirt for a neater look or leave it untucked for a more relaxed vibe.
- Casual Shirts: Plaid flannel shirts, chambray shirts, or henley shirts add a touch of personality. Rolling up the sleeves can give a more laid-back feel.
- Hoodies and Sweatshirts: For colder days, opt for a fitted hoodie or sweatshirt in neutral or bold colors. Layer with a denim or bomber jacket for added style.
- Footwear: Sneakers, loafers, or casual boots complement this look. White sneakers are especially popular for a clean, modern appearance.
Example: Combine black straight fit jeans with a white crew neck t-shirt, a grey hoodie, and white sneakers for an easy, stylish casual outfit.
Smart Casual: Balancing Comfort and Elegance
Transitioning from casual to smart casual involves incorporating slightly more polished pieces while maintaining comfort. Black straight fit jeans serve as an excellent foundation for this style.
- Button-Down Shirts: Choose crisp white, light blue, or patterned shirts. Tuck in the shirt and add a belt for a refined touch.
- Blazers and Jackets: A tailored blazer, a sleek cardigan, or a leather jacket can elevate your look. Opt for neutral tones like navy, grey, or black.
- Footwear: Leather loafers, brogues, or desert boots pair well here, adding sophistication without overdoing it.
- Accessories: Minimalist watches, leather belts, and subtle jewelry can enhance the ensemble.
Example: Wear black straight fit jeans with a light blue button-down shirt, a navy blazer, and brown loafers for a sharp, smart casual look suitable for dinners or casual office settings.
Formal and Business Casual: Elevating Your Style
While black jeans are not traditional formal wear, they can be styled appropriately for business casual or semi-formal events with the right pieces. The key is to keep the look sleek and polished.
- Dress Shirts: Opt for well-fitted dress shirts in solid colors or subtle patterns. Tuck in the shirt for a cleaner appearance.
- Blazers and Suit Jackets: A tailored blazer or a slim-fit suit jacket in dark colors complements the jeans without making the outfit overly formal.
- Footwear: Formal leather shoes, such as oxfords or derby shoes, add sophistication.
- Accessories: Use a leather belt matching your shoes, a classic watch, and perhaps a pocket square for added elegance.
Example: Combine black straight fit jeans with a crisp white dress shirt, a black blazer, and polished black oxford shoes for a modern twist on business casual attire.
Seasonal Styling Tips
Adapting your outfits with the seasons ensures comfort and style throughout the year. Here are some tips for styling black straight fit jeans across different seasons:
- Spring and Summer: Light fabrics like linen shirts or polo shirts combined with loafers or sneakers work well. Opt for lighter accessories and sunglasses for a fresh look.
- Autumn: Layer with sweaters, cardigans, or jackets. Incorporate earthy tones such as olive, rust, or charcoal for a warm aesthetic.
- Winter: Pair with thermal shirts, knit sweaters, and heavy coats. Boots and scarves can add both warmth and style.

Footwear Choices to Complement Black Straight Fit Jeans
Footwear plays a crucial role in defining your outfit's vibe. Here are some options tailored to different styles:
- Casual: White or colorful sneakers, slip-on shoes, or desert boots.
- Smart Casual: Loafers, Chelsea boots, or brogues in leather or suede.
- Formal: Oxfords, derby shoes, or monk straps in polished leather.
Matching your shoes with your belt and accessories ensures a cohesive look.
Color Coordination and Pattern Mixing
Black straight fit jeans serve as a neutral base, allowing you to experiment with various colors and patterns. Here are some tips:
- Color Pairings: Pair with neutral tops like white, grey, or navy for classic looks. Bold colors like burgundy, emerald green, or mustard can add personality.
- Pattern Mixing: Combine striped or checked shirts with solid accessories. Keep patterns subtle to avoid overwhelming the outfit.
